M922 SBL is a 1995 BMW 520 in Black with a 1,991c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1995 BMW 520 models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.4% with a typical mileage of 125,342 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 520 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 47,121 recorded failures. If you're considering buying M922 SBL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 520 typ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 31 years old, this BMW 520 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
